Why Miami? Best Seasons and Getting There
Miami is a premier destination known for its stunning beaches, vibrant culture, and a plethora of venue options. The best time to visit is from December to April when the weather is pleasant, but expect higher rates during peak tourist season. Miami International Airport (MIA) is only 15 minutes from downtown, making it an accessible choice for travel.

Budget Breakdown
Here’s a sample budget breakdown for a team of 10:
| Category | Cost | Percentage | |------------------------|------------|-------------| | Venue | $1,500 | 15% | | Food & Beverage | $2,000 | 20% | | Activities | $1,500 | 15% | | Travel | $1,500 | 15% | | Accommodations | $3,000 | 30% | | Contingency | $500 | 5% | | Total | $10,000| 100% |
Note: Adjust based on the chosen venue and specific needs.
Timeline for Planning Your Retreat
8-Week Planning Timeline
- 8 Weeks Out: Finalize retreat goals and objectives.
- 7 Weeks Out: Choose venue and book dates.
- 6 Weeks Out: Confirm F&B options and any special requirements.
- 5 Weeks Out: Plan activities and book vendors.
- 4 Weeks Out: Send out invites and collect RSVPs.
- 2 Weeks Out: Confirm all logistics and check-in details.
- 1 Week Out: Finalize agenda and share with attendees.
- Day of Retreat: Execute agenda and ensure smooth operations.
Risk Mitigation
Planning can come with its hurdles. Here are some common risks and how to mitigate them:
-
Risk: Last-minute cancellations by attendees.
- Mitigation: Set clear deadlines for RSVP and consider a waitlist.
-
Risk: Venue issues (e.g., double bookings).
- Mitigation: Confirm details in writing and maintain open communication with the venue.
-
Risk: Budget overruns.
- Mitigation: Keep a contingency fund and track expenses closely.
